Bitcoin Asia Conference Highlights

At the Bitcoin Asia Conference, Mova, a public blockchain, officially unveiled its mainnet and secured important collaborations including one with the Join the Planet Foundation, spearheaded by football superstar Lionel Messi.

Performance Metrics

Wael Muhaisen, the CEO of Mova, shared that during the testing phase, the platform achieved a remarkable throughput of 110,000 transactions per second (TPS) and an impressive confirmation time of just 1.5 seconds.

Compliance Features

Moreover, Mova incorporates essential compliance features at its core, such as KYC/AML protocols, account tagging, and on-chain audits, establishing it as a robust infrastructure for compliant global payments and the issuance of real-world assets (RWA).

Partnership with Join the Planet Foundation

Shady, a founding partner of the Join the Planet Foundation, articulated the partnership’s mission: “Together, we aim to create environmentally sustainable NFTs. Our collaboration is rooted in shared values of responsibility. The expertise and technical prowess of the Mova team are truly commendable. The importance of transparency and traceability cannot be understated in our initiatives, and Mova serves as the perfect platform for our goal.”

Funding and Valuation

In a prior development, Mova raised significant capital with a valuation of $100 million, a funding round led by the Aqua1 Foundation and GeoNova Capital, a UAE-based investment fund established by Standard Chartered Bank in conjunction with several local institutions and family offices, alongside contributions from top financial entities in Abu Dhabi.
